Transaction

8101bc8afdac996ffe60869959e88160bcdc2d9f55dfec41b3f22472dcdbbf29
58,689 confirmations
Timestamp
1737403068
Block880,113
Fee7,722 sats
Fee rate9 sats/vB
view on mempool.space

Inputs & Outputs